Our partner is at the forefront of energy innovation—designing and building high-performance lithium battery systems that power everything from marine to specialty vehicles. We’re looking for a hands‑on, solutions‑driven Automation Engineer to play a critical role in advancing our manufacturing capabilities and supporting our rapid growth.

If you thrive in a dynamic, fast‑paced production environment and enjoy solving complex technical challenges, this is your opportunity to make a tangible impact.

What You’ll Do Drive Automation Excellence
  • Serve as the technical lead for automated systems, including our Laser Welding Line, ensuring safe, stable, and repeatable production
  • Troubleshoot automation, controls, and equipment issues to minimize downtime and maintain throughput
  • Optimize processes to improve cycle time, yield, and overall equipment effectiveness (OEE)
  • Support new product introductions (NPI), including equipment setup, validation, and readiness
Strengthen Equipment Reliability
  • Support maintenance and reliability programs across automated and semi-automated manufacturing systems
  • Diagnose and resolve electrical, mechanical, pneumatic, and controls issues
  • Partner with Maintenance and Operations to drive equipment upgrades and improvements
  • Lead root cause analysis and corrective actions for recurring failures
Support Cutting-Edge Battery Systems
  • Provide technical expertise for the Balancing Work Center and charger systems
  • Assist in designing, building, and commissioning battery chargers and related equipment
  • Maintain and troubleshoot balancing and charging systems to ensure safe operation
  • Develop and maintain documentation, wiring diagrams, and technical standards
Advanced Controls & Technology
  • Support PLCs, HMIs, motion systems, vision systems, and industrial networks
  • Assist with programming updates, integration, and continuous system improvements
  • Maintain electrical schematics, controls documentation, and software backups
Lead Continuous Improvement
  • Contribute to initiatives focused on safety, quality, cost, and delivery
  • Support capital projects from equipment selection through commissioning (FAT/SAT)
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Engineering, Quality, Supply Chain, and Operations
What You Bring
  • Bachelor’s degree in Automation, Electrical, Mechanical, Mechatronics, or Manufacturing Engineering (or related field)
  • 3+ years of experience supporting automated manufacturing equipment
  • Strong hands‑on expertise with PLCs, HMIs, sensors, and industrial networks
  • Programming experience (C, C++, Python, or G‑Code preferred)
  • Proven troubleshooting skills across electrical, mechanical, and controls systems
  • Ability to read and interpret electrical schematics and technical documentation
  • Working knowledge of industrial safety standards (LOTO, machine guarding, etc.)
  • Strong problem‑solving mindset and ability to drive root‑cause solutions
  • Excellent collaboration and communication skills
